Table FPSAPP.EQP_PROCESS_CHG_TO_IGNORE"
This is the configuration table to store the recipes and/or setups to ignore the change. Ignore basically means that we keep the previous value as the current recipe or setup.
-
Schema: FPSAPP
-
Tablespace: FPSDATA
-
Primary key: TOOL, CHANGE_TYPE, CHANGE_VALUE, FACILITY
-
Foreign keys: EQP_PROCESS_CHG_IGNORE_FK_TOOL: FACILITY, TOOL REFERENCES FPSINPUT.EQP_TOOLS (FACILITY, TOOL)

|
TOOL |
VARCHAR2(16) |
N |
Tool is generally just the main tool. The exception is when different entities on the tool run completely independently and it is physically impossible to run wafers of the same lot across multiple entities. In this exception case, we may want to assign the entities to different eqp_types and therefore we should define each entity as a tool. Please note that when we do this there is no indication whatsoever that these different entities are on the same tool. (* from FPSINPUT.EQP_TOOLS) |
|
CHANGE_TYPE |
VARCHAR2(64) |
N |
This must be either RECIPE or SETUP. |
|
CHANGE_VALUE |
VARCHAR2(100) |
N |
The value of the RECIPE or SETUP to ignore. We also have two special values for this field, Missing and No Setup. We insert a record for Missing for either RECIPE or SETUP if we want to ignore the recipe or setup change on the tool when the lot-route-step has no record in WIP_STEP_FUT_ASSIGNMENTS. We insert a record for No Setup only for SETUP if we want to ignore the setup change on the tool for a record with no setup information. |
|
FACILITY |
VARCHAR2(6) |
N |
Facility is included in almost every join in the DWH so this represents a definitive split. A route must have all steps on tools in the same facility. A tool must process all lots in the same facility. If your site has multiple buildings where lots run on routes using tools in multiple buildings then everything should be one facility. For example, multiple Fab buildings. But if your site has independent facilities like Fab and Test and Assembly where lot may progress from one to the next but on different routes then these should be different facilities. Since this column is in virtually every table it is critical that the value here is exactly matches what is in the MES if the MES has facility. Use facility_display for the display friendly name displayed in applications. See site_name comment for client/site/facility example. (* from FPSINPUT.GEN_FACILITIES) |
|
DESCRIPTION |
VARCHAR2(256) |
An optional description field to add why we are ignoring. |
